All lead acid batteries discharge when in storage – a process known as 'calendar fade' – so the right environment and active maintenance are essential to ensure the batteries maintain their ability to achieve fill capacity. This is true of both flooded lead acid and sealed lead acid batteries. The ideal storage temperature is 50°F (10°C).

Lead acid batteries are rechargeable batteries that use a chemical reaction between lead and sulfuric acid to generate electrical energy. These batteries consist of lead plates immersed in a solution of sulfuric acid, known as the electrolyte.
